New folks: the parcel-tracking webhook receives carrier scan events from the Dovetrail aggregator and writes them to the shipment_events table after schema validation. Duplicate deliveries are expected — the handler is idempotent on event_uid, so never remove that constraint. Failed payloads land in the dead-letter table with the raw body intact for replay. When debugging a missing scan, always check dead letters before assuming the carrier dropped it. For local inspection of the events store, use the connection string below.

database URL for bagap-yahap: mysql://druax_svc:s0i8rHw@db-fdc1.orvexworks.local:5432/druius

The freeze covers permanent and fixed-term roles; internal transfers require sign-off from divisional leadership. Offers already extended will be honoured. Contractor headcount is capped at current levels.

The decision follows softer-than-expected volumes on the Renholt corridor and a review of warehouse automation timelines. Backfills for safety-critical roles may be approved case by case. For the board's awareness, the rationale connects directly to the plans noted below.

internal memo for kaduf-baduf: Only 35 of the 378 pilot accounts renewed Holir, so a churn review is set for June 11. Eliielax Group is in early talks to buy Silaelix Group for about $142.1 million.

## Weekend Lift Maintenance

Heads up: the lifts at Copperstile Tower get serviced most weekends, usually Saturday mornings. If you're in the office then, you'll need to use the north stairwell instead — the lift lobby doors are locked while the Harkwell engineers are on site. The stairwell doors on floors 2–5 accept your normal badge, but the ground-floor door needs the code below.

staff pass of kawip-hawef = bdg-QLP-2